Output 80b81b0ed023fea5d28a73ca721c8f637af9315bf6cc647fd1be9a593218b7e9:1

value
1935536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e052fa5e26c033e44697e126ce0762b86ade1f OP_EQUAL
address
3DST9QrMuXvL5iDCbteCUTfNYLkq9y7pm1
transaction
80b81b0ed023fea5d28a73ca721c8f637af9315bf6cc647fd1be9a593218b7e9
spent
true